- ELA = English Language Arts (reading and writing). Math and Science are self-explanatory.
- NY State tests ELA and Math every year in grades 3-8, and Science once, in grade 8 -- a school's numbers below only reflect whichever of those grades it actually serves (no social studies/history state test exists at this level).
- "Avg. rating" is DOE's average student score on a 1.0-4.5 scale (higher is better) -- shown here as "value / 4.5" alongside the citywide average for the same metric as a benchmark for what's typical.

Admissions cycle
1. Students who live in the zone and have a sibling at the school.
2. Other students who live in the zone.
3. Students who live in the district and have a sibling at the school.
4. Students who live outside the district and have a sibling at the school.
5. Students who live in the district who are currently enrolled at the school for pre-K.
6. Students who live outside the district who are currently enrolled at the school for pre-K.
7. Other students who live in the district.
8. Other students who live outside the district.
